基于QT5.7的STM32F103串口升级上位机源码
简介
本项目提供了一个基于QT5.7开发的上位机源码,用于通过串口对STM32F103单片机进行IAP(In-Application Programming)固件升级。该上位机的设计原理可以移植到其他控制器,实现STM32单片机的远程固件升级。经过实际测试,该上位机稳定可靠,适用于需要远程升级固件的场景。
功能特点
- 串口IAP升级:通过串口实现STM32F103的固件升级。
- 可移植性:升级原理可移植到其他控制器,实现远程固件升级。
- 稳定性:经过实际测试,确保升级过程稳定可靠。
使用说明
- 环境配置:确保你的开发环境已安装QT5.7或更高版本。
- 源码下载:从本仓库下载源码。
- 编译运行:使用QT Creator打开项目文件,编译并运行程序。
- 连接设备:将上位机与STM32F103单片机通过串口连接。
- 固件升级:按照上位机的操作指引进行固件升级。
贡献
欢迎各位开发者贡献代码,提出改进建议或报告问题。请通过提交Issue或Pull Request的方式参与本项目。
许可证
本项目采用MIT许可证,允许自由使用和修改源码,但需保留原作者的版权声明。
联系方式
如有任何问题或建议,请联系项目维护者:
- 邮箱:[your-email@example.com]
- 微信:[your-wechat]
感谢您的关注和支持!